Standards

I believe in the evil that is society.

The idea tht if you're not ookie-cutter, you're not beautiful

The peer pressure that builds every day

The unfair treatment of those undeserving of it

The undeniable amount of greed

Taking all they can, giving nothing back, mocking you always.

 

But the belief that you are not able to push back from

All of this insanity kills me bit by bit.

 

I believe in individuality.

I believe in the diamond-in-the-rough.

I believe in power to overcome anything with

Strength, determination, and fearlessness.

 

And I believe that somewhere in this wasteland, someone

Is going to be willing to challenge unjust beliefs, and fight

For who we are; the imperfect.
